News in Brief from BMW Group UK.
Wed Jun 04 11:00:00 CEST 2025 Press Release
• BMW named Electric Car Brand of the Year at the Which? Awards. • Top Gear names the BMW i5 Touring Best EV Estate at annual awards. • BMW 7 Series wins Best Fleet Luxury Car at The Great British Fleet Awards 2025. • MINI Aceman customers can now specify a towbar supporting a load of up to 750 kg.
BMW recently celebrated another successful May, having garnered a
trio of accolades at industry events including the 2025 Which? Awards,
Top Gear EV Awards and The Great British Fleet Awards. Meanwhile, MINI
Aceman customers can benefit from an optional towbar supporting a load
of up to 750 kg.
BMW named Electric Car Brand of the Year at the Which?
Awards.
Inaugurated in 2007, the Which? Awards celebrate
and reward the best businesses in the UK that consistently deliver for
their customers. At this year’s ceremony, BMW was presented the
coveted Electric Car Brand of the Year accolade – awarded for
demonstrating dependable EV reliability across Which? surveys and for
an innovative, safe and electrically-efficient product portfolio.

MINI Aceman customers can now specify a towbar supporting a
load of up to 750 kg.
Following the launch of the MINI
Aceman last year, customers can now benefit from an expanded options
portfolio with the addition of a new towbar. Offering a capacity of up
to 750 kg – perfect for towing small trailers and bicycle carriers –
this new option is available for the MINI Aceman SE and MINI John
Cooper Works Aceman.

The BMW Group
With its four brands BMW, MINI, Rolls-Royce and BMW Motorrad, the BMW Group is the world’s leading premium manufacturer of automobiles and motorcycles and also provides premium financial services. The BMW Group production network comprises over 30 production sites worldwide; the company has a global sales network in more than 140 countries.
In 2024, the BMW Group sold over 2.45 million passenger vehicles and more than 210,000 motorcycles worldwide. The profit before tax in the financial year 2024 was € 11.0 billion on revenues amounting to € 142.4 billion. As of 31 December 2024, the BMW Group had a workforce of 159,104 employees.
The economic success of the BMW Group has always been based on long-term thinking and responsible action. Sustainability is a key element of the BMW Group’s corporate strategy and covers all products from the supply chain and production to the end of their useful life.
